Transaction 109788d592fc769ff3b46f3523f8e2ba4f691804eff7b2a233f60e24f985a94f

2 Input
2 Outputs
  • 109788d592fc769ff3b46f3523f8e2ba4f691804eff7b2a233f60e24f985a94f:0
  • value  3050313
    address  18KFBaRgmaqiVeoH1RppqnL8k5ZPtsXftF
  • 109788d592fc769ff3b46f3523f8e2ba4f691804eff7b2a233f60e24f985a94f:1
  • value  279103
    address  3Jx1ThGhh5P9vL5XkMw1NauH2YEDSZo4Wd